Miami Florida basketball refers to the men's basketball program that represents the University of Miami. Competing in the Atlantic Coast Conference (ACC), the team has a rich history and dedicated fan base.

The Hurricanes have won multiple conference championships and advanced to the NCAA Tournament on numerous occasions, showcasing their talent and resilience. Their success on the court has brought recognition to the university and the state of Florida, inspiring future generations of basketball players.
